The Legacy of 007 and the Anatomy of a Franchise Reboot
The James Bond franchise stands as one of the most enduring properties in cinema history, spanning over six decades and twenty-five canonical films. Every transition between actors—from Sean Connery to George Lazenby, Roger Moore, Timothy Dalton, Pierce Brosnan, and Daniel Craig—has required a careful recalibration of tone, style, and cultural relevance. The upcoming era faces a unique challenge: modernizing the Cold War espionage archetype for a digital-first geopolitical landscape defined by cyber warfare, AI surveillance, and shifting global superpowers.

Where to Stream and How to Watch the James Bond Library Today
For fans looking to revisit the history of the franchise while awaiting official casting announcements, accessing the complete catalog has never been easier. Following Amazon's acquisition of MGM, the entire 25-film official Eon library is available for streaming, renting, and digital purchase across major platforms worldwide.
